phil dekked Posted February 4, 2006 Share Posted February 4, 2006 please please can anybody explain how to set the limiters on my bss fds 320/340 or let me know where I can get a manual from ? ? ? Thought the 340 limiters were set by a little grub screw next to each channel on the front panel...? http://www.nottinghamtec.co.uk/~jp/ebay/IMGP0155.JPG the line from the limiter light to TH (threshold) set points to it..? Not sure for the 320 but thought it was the same? .p.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

ianl Posted February 4, 2006 Share Posted February 4, 2006 turn it up as loud as you want it to go, then adjust the screw so the red light is on. its a multi turn screw so you may have to do a number of complete revolutions to set it. also bare in mind that they are not that great limiters, they don't give absolute protection like modern limiters might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
